Epic Blue Low Carb Pale Ale Cans 6x330ml

A Low Carb beer that just isn't about being low carb, it is about the flavour. It is a Low Carb Pale Ale that has the incredible hop aroma and hop flavour you expect from a typical Epic beer. Luke Nicholas owner/founder of Epic Brewing Company says 'we were shocked when reading that Low Carb beer sales were greater than the total Craft Beer market in New Zealand. On hearing this I could feel the pain of a great number of drinkers who were drinking low carb, but at the cost of a really delicious beer. It was time to help them out, as we did back in 2005 when we helped the whole of the New Zealand beer market with the wonderfully dry hopped Epic Pale Ale'.

Estrella Damm Bottles 12x330ml

This beer takes its name from Estrella the Spanish word for 'star' and Damm, the founding family's name. Since 1876 this beer has been brewed according to the original recipe. Golden in colour, this crisp lager is rounded with dark-roasted notes to give it personality and final flavour.

Export 33 Bottles 15x330ml

A refreshingly lively lager with hints of tropical, fruit like notes and a mild bitterness. DB Export 33 has an ABV of 4.6%. This full flavoured lager was launched in 2008 and named 'Best Low Carbohydrate Beer in New Zealand' in 2009 and 2010 at the NZ Beer Awards. It also became the first New Zealand low carb beer to win a Gold medal at the prestigious Monde Selection awards in Belgium in 2010, winning Gold again in 2011.
